Impossible Beef Enchilada Pie

Yield: 6 to 8 servings

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up chopped onion
  • 2 cloves garlic, finely chopped
  • 2 teaspoons ch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ano leaves
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 8 ounces taco sauce
  • 2/3 cup finely crushed tortilla chips
  • 2 cups (8 ounces) shredded Cheddar cheese, divided
  • 1 1/4 cups milk
  • 3 eggs
  • 3/4 cup Bisquick or Biscuit Baking Mix

Instructions

  1. Heat oven to 400 degrees F. Grease a 10 inch pie plate.
  2. Cook and stir ground beef, onion and garlic until brown; drain.
  3. Stir in chili powder, oregano, salt, pepper and 1/2 cup taco sauce.
  4. Sprinkle tortilla chips evenly in plate.
  5. Top with 1 1/2 cups cheese; spread with beef mixture.
  6. Beat milk, eggs and baking mix until smooth, 15 seconds in blender on high or for 1 minute with hand beater.
  7. Pour into plate.
  8. Bake until knife inserted in center comes out clean, 25 to 30 minutes.
  9. Spread remaining taco sauce over top; sprinkle with remaining cheese.
  10. Bake until cheese is melted, 3 to 5 minutes. Cool for 10 minutes.
  11. Serve with chopped tomato, shredded lettuce and sour cream if desired.
